Do Our Votes Really Count? * Leon County, Florida recently found out how easily their Diebold electronic voting machines can be hacked into and votes changed. "I am positive an eighth grader could do this" said Herbert Thompson, computer science professor and software tester. [Miami Herald, 12/15/05] Diebold machines are in operation all over the country! * Many e-voting machines have no "paper trail" and when errors occur there is no recourse and critical recounts cannot take place. Congress has had numerous bills presented over the past two years to correct this problem but has not passed a single one. The most promising has been held up in committee since 2004. Some updates on ’04 The GAO (Government Accounting Office) which reports to Congress issued a report in October 2005 on the safety of electronic voting. It indicated that:
In Leon City, FL in December 2005, Finnish security expert Harry Hursti proved that Diebold had misinformed secretaries of state and other election officials when it claimed votes could not be changed on the memory card. He used a credit card sized memory card and changed the results of the votes cast, in an experiment with known votes. It sent the incorrect vote to the central tabulator which pulls in votes from all the machines and it read the programmed incorrect vote. Similar tests have been conducted on machines in CA with similar results. ELECTION 2000 Update In FL 2000, Presidential candidate Gore "lost" by 537 votes when the Supreme Court stopped the FL recount. Gore had won the US popular vote by over 500,000 votes. A recently published book on the ’00 FL vote by Lance deHaven Smith: The Battle for Florida, analyzes that vote. He found that there were 175,000 "spoiled" ballots (under and overvotes). 116,500 were overvotes; the majority were for Gore. Some were for Bush. Here, people punched a vote for Gore, and then wrote him in, too. This happened mostly in Democratic and minority areas. The author speculates that voters used to being disenfranchised wanted to be sure that their votes were counted for their candidate. Florida law says "no vote shall be declared invalid or void if there is a clear indication of the intent of the vote". There was no question of the voters’ intent in these ballots, but they were disenfranchised by the Supremes. Had the votes been counted, Gore would have won FL and thus the election and it would have been President Gore, not Bush.
